An Act establishing the Essential Energy Stability Fund Pilot Program to provide limited, off-season utility assistance to eligible low-income households; and making an appropriation.
HB 1778 establishes a pilot program called the Essential Energy Stability Fund to provide limited financial assistance for utility bills to eligible low-income households during off-season periods (outside regular peak billing cycles). The fund would use a dedicated state appropriation to help households manage unexpected energy costs when they might face financial strain. This temporary program is designed to test whether targeted off-season support can improve energy affordability for vulnerable residents. The bill focuses on concrete funding for direct assistance, not broader policy changes.
